Hi I was in Margaret Bevin in 1954 I hated everything about it I was only there about a week and me and another girl I can’t remember her name hide in the garden when the girls went to wash there hands for dinner and we ran away has we we’re running up station road there was a black dog chasing us but we carried on we got on the tram to Woodside we had no money we got under the seat we done the same on the boat and the tram in Liverpool I can’t even remember
The girls name that was with me I wish I did
my name was mary Silcock ( it was the
worse time of my life I hated every minute of
it a girl put a pillow over my head and tried to
smother me ( and if you spoke after a certain
time you had to stand in the hall under the
clock it was the worst time of my life ( when I
got home a police man came to see was I
safe I locked my self in he bedroom and
wouldn’t come out ( I think we should have
been compensated for the time we were
there
Mary Silcock
